Why are there no +missile damage or range or whatever hardwired implants? I have searched both the online database and the market in game (showing even unavailable items), and found a wide array of gunnery mods, for every kind of turret and for essentially every key gunnery stat, and in varying strength. However I haven't seen a single one that affects missiles. Does anyone know why that is?

It's because prepatch, there were so few stats to even boost with missiles, plus the fact they were very effective without any help, that there wasn't a need for them.
However, I really really think there needs to be some hardwires put in for the new missile skills very soon. If they would have put them in at patch release, it might have alleviated the need for everyone to train up their new missile skills for so long to be good, but seeing as the time for that is past, they should just put them in asap.
Think about it, right now, regardless of if many people use them or not, turret users can get basically ALL their turret skills to level 6 with no training time. That's a massive bonus, one which missile users, now already behind on skills, have no way to achieve. Makes it very unbalanced post patch.
